Overview of Cardiff Metropolitan University's Rankings

Cardiff Metropolitan University (Cardiff Met) has established itself as a respected institution in the UK higher education landscape, known for its practical, career-focused programs and strong emphasis on student experience. While not always in the top tier of global rankings, Cardiff Met consistently performs well in areas such as teaching quality, employability, and subject-specific excellence. Its rankings reflect a commitment to applied learning, industry partnerships, and regional impact, particularly in Wales. This overview draws from recent data (primarily 2023-2024 cycles) from reputable sources like the Complete University Guide, The Guardian University Guide, Times Higher Education (THE), and QS World University Rankings. Rankings can fluctuate annually based on methodology, but Cardiff Met's steady improvement highlights its growing reputation.

National UK Rankings

In the UK, Cardiff Met is evaluated through several key national frameworks that prioritize student satisfaction, entry standards, and graduate outcomes. These rankings position the university as a solid choice for those seeking value-for-money education with strong vocational elements.

  • Complete University Guide 2024: Cardiff Met ranks 94th out of 130 UK universities. This placement is bolstered by high scores in student satisfaction (78%) and graduate prospects (78%). The guide assesses factors like research quality (weighted at 20%) and teaching quality (30%), where Cardiff Met scores competitively in applied disciplines.
  • The Guardian University Guide 2024: Here, Cardiff Met achieves a stronger 71st position overall. The Guardian emphasizes value-added metrics, such as progression from entry to graduation, where the university excels (top 50 for continuation rates). Its 'satisfied with course' score stands at 85%, reflecting positive feedback on teaching and support.
  • National Student Survey (NSS) Integration: Cardiff Met's overall student satisfaction rate is 82% (2023 NSS), above the sector average of 79%. This is particularly evident in categories like learning resources (87%) and academic support (84%), contributing to its upward trajectory in satisfaction-based rankings.

Compared to other Welsh universities, Cardiff Met often outperforms in employability-focused metrics. For instance, in the 2023 Welsh university comparisons by the Welsh Government, it ranks highly for skills development and regional economic contribution.

International Rankings

On the global stage, Cardiff Met's rankings are more modest due to the emphasis on research output and international reputation in major indices. However, it shines in impact-oriented rankings that align with its mission of practical education and sustainability.

  • Times Higher Education (THE) World University Rankings 2024: Cardiff Met falls in the 601-800 band globally (out of over 1,900 institutions). In the THE Impact Rankings 2023, which measure UN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s), it ranks 301-400 worldwide, with strong performances in SDG 4 (Quality Education) and SDG 8 (Decent Work and Economic Growth). This underscores the university's focus on real-world application and ethical practices.
  • QS World University Rankings 2024: Cardiff Met does not feature in the top 1,000 overall, but it gains recognition in subject-specific QS rankings (detailed below). QS methodologies heavily weight academic reputation (40%) and employer reputation (10%), areas where Cardiff Met is building through alumni success stories.
  • ShanghaiRanking's Academic Ranking of World Universities (ARWU) 2023: The university is not ranked in the top 1,000, as ARWU prioritizes research citations and Nobel laureates—metrics less aligned with Cardiff Met's teaching-led profile. Nonetheless, its research in health and sport sciences garners citations in niche global databases.

Internationally, Cardiff Met's appeal lies in its affordability and accessibility for international students, ranking in the top 20 UK universities for international student satisfaction (i-graduate 2023), with a score of 4.2/5.

Subject-Specific Rankings

Cardiff Met's strengths are most evident in vocational and professional subjects, where it often ranks in the UK top 50 or higher. The university offers over 200 programs across six academic schools, with particular excellence in health, sport, education, and business.

Key highlights from the Complete University Guide 2024 subject rankings include:

Subject Area UK Rank Key Strengths
Sport and Exercise Sciences 10th World-class facilities at the Cardiff Centre for Welsh Sport; 95% graduate employability; research in performance analysis.
Nursing 22nd High clinical placement hours (2,300+); partnerships with NHS Wales; 90% satisfaction in teaching quality.
Education 35th Focus on inclusive practices; top 20 for student voice; strong PGCE outcomes.
Business and Management 45th AACSB-accredited Cardiff School of Management; 85% employability; emphasis on entrepreneurship.
Psychology 62nd BPS-accredited programs; research in well-being; high research impact scores.
Art and Design Top 70 Industry collaborations; state-of-the-art studios; notable alumni in creative industries.

In QS Subject Rankings 2023, Cardiff Met's Sports-related subjects rank in the 151-200 global band, benefiting from facilities like the £14 million Sport Wales National Centre. Similarly, in THE Subject Rankings 2023, its Education discipline is in the 401-500 range internationally, praised for pedagogical innovation.

These rankings demonstrate Cardiff Met's niche expertise. For example, its International Journal of Performance Analysis in Sport (published by the university) is a leading outlet, cited over 5,000 times annually, enhancing its academic footprint.

Employability and Graduate Outcomes

One of Cardiff Met's standout areas is graduate employability, where it consistently ranks above average. According to the Graduate Outcomes Survey 2022 (15 months post-graduation):

  • 95% of graduates are in work or further study.
  • 80% in highly skilled professions (up from 75% in 2020).
  • Average starting salary: £26,000, competitive for post-1992 universities.

In the Complete University Guide's Graduate Prospects metric, Cardiff Met scores 78/100, placing it in the UK top 80. Employers value its programs for producing 'work-ready' graduates; partnerships with organizations like the BBC, NHS, and Adidas ensure practical experience. The university's Careers and Employability Service boasts a 92% satisfaction rate, offering personalized support including CV clinics and networking events.

Research and Innovation Rankings

Cardiff Met is research-active, with 70% of its activity rated 'world-leading' or 'internationally excellent' in the Research Excellence Framework (REF) 2021. While overall research income (£10m+ annually) is modest compared to research-intensive universities, it punches above its weight in applied fields.

  • REF 2021: 100% of research impactful in health sciences; top 30 in UK for allied health research environment.
  • Innovation Metrics: Ranked in the top 50 UK universities for Knowledge Transfer Partnerships (KTPs) by Innovate UK (2023), fostering business-academia links.

The university's zero-fee incubation space, ZERO1, supports startups, contributing to its 4th place in Wales for enterprise education (National Centre for Universities and Business, 2023).

Sustainability and Inclusivity

Cardiff Met is committed to sustainability, earning a First-Class Award in the 2023 People & Planet University League (28th in UK). It ranks highly for environmental initiatives, such as carbon-neutral goals by 2030 and biodiversity projects on campus.

In terms of inclusivity, the university scores 85% in the 2023 Advance HE Athena SWAN awards for gender equality and holds the Race Equality Charter Bronze Award. Its widening participation efforts rank it top 20 in the UK for access to underrepresented groups (Office for Students, 2023).
